yolov8的初始学习率
时间: 2024-05-14 12:11:18 浏览: 28
很抱歉,目前并不存在 YOLOv8,可能您想要了解的是 YOLOv5。YOLOv5 是目前较为流行的目标检测算法之一,其初始学习率可以根据训练数据集的大小、网络结构等进行调整。在 YOLOv5 中,通常会采用学习率衰减的方式来逐渐减小初始学习率。例如,可以使用 cosine annealing 来调整学习率,具体实现可以参考 YOLOv5 的源代码。
相关问题
yolov8 初始学习率和最终学习率这么设置
YoloV8是目标检测领域中的一种模型,其学习率的设置需要结合具体的训练数据和硬件设备进行调整。一般来说,可以采用学习率衰减的策略,即初始学习率设置较大,然后随着训练的进行不断地减小学习率,直到最终学习率。常见的学习率衰减策略包括步长衰减、余弦退火、多项式退火等。其中,余弦退火策略在YoloV8中比较常用,可以通过设置初始学习率、最终学习率、训练轮数等参数来进行调整。
一般来说,初始学习率可以设置为较大的值,如0.01或0.001,最终学习率可以设置为初始学习率的1/100或1/1000等较小的值。同时,训练轮数也需要根据具体的数据集和硬件设备来进行调整,一般需要进行多次试验来确定最佳的学习率衰减策略和参数设置。
yolov7初始学习率
YOLOv7(You Only Look Once version 7)是一款先进的目标检测算法,它属于YOLO系列,通常深度学习模型的初始学习率设置对训练过程至关重要,因为它影响模型权重更新的速度。初始学习率的选择需要考虑多个因素,如网络架构的复杂性、数据集的大小和质量、优化器类型等。
对于YOLOv7,由于其相对较大的模型规模和深度,初始学习率可能会设置得相对较低,例如在使用SGD(随机梯度下降)或Adam优化器时,初始学习率可能在1e-4到1e-3之间。但是,具体的数值可能需要进行实验调整,因为最佳学习率会根据具体情况进行微调,可能需要通过学习率衰减策略(如cosine annealing或exponential decay)来逐步降低学习率,以帮助模型更好地收敛。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)